Taps

The bugle sounds its final call
  the echoes die away
darkness now has fallen
  although it is mid-day.

The flag is being folded
  to be given to your wife;
your children stand bewildered
  at this strange twist in life.

Another hero has fallen
  and now he lies at rest.
The world's a darker place now
  for he was one of the best.
